I have a Galahad 240, the rad is at the top blowing out..
The in/out pipes on the rad need to be above the cpu block, if not you could get air bubbles and the coolant won't circulate properly..
I had to reseat the block a couple of times as it need to be dead flat and the fixing being only 2 screws can be a little fiddly to get right..
Also your pump needs to be at 100%, make sure it's plugged into the AIO/WB header..
